Westie Rescue USA remembers all the Westies who have left us way to early.
Each week Westie Rescue receives that sad message that one of the Westies we have placed has gone to the Rainbow Bridge to wait for us to join them among the clouds. They leave behind a hole in our lives that can never be filled. However, over the passage of time another Westie comes along that has our name written all over them.
We have been finding those best buddies in waiting for the past 33 years to fill in that unused dog bed, spot on the couch and that special lookout spot to keep a watch on their domain free of squirrels, the postman/UPS guy/ and the Amazon delivery team.
My own best buddy, Fergus, passed away last year after giving me 17 years of companionship on long road trips to pickup or drop off Westies seeking a second chance at a new life. He allowed those Westies to be held and cooed over while they stayed in foster care. He was the Westie Rescue ambassador at Scottish Festivals for 16+ years and fastest squirrel tail chaser all over the yard. He will be missed as will all Westies who leave our arms way too soon. We wipe away a tear at their memories....
